From 9ef023006d8b94b892ec4cf5b05e5d4278af6451 Mon Sep 17 00:00:00 2001 From: David Kilroy Date: Sun, 9 Oct 2011 12:11:36 +0100 Subject: [PATCH] staging: wlags49_h2: Fixup IW_AUTH handling Handle more cases in IW_AUTH. Avoid reporting errors (invalid parameter) on operations that we can't do anything with. Return -EINPROGRESS from some operations to get wpa_supplicant to batch and commit changes. In other operations apply the changes immediately. Avoid writing WEP keys from the commit handler when WEP is not being used. Accept WPA_VERSION_DISABLED, which is received from wpa_supplicant during WEP.
